CEO Perspective: Rajeev Singh, CEO of Accolade

From the CEOs Perspective

When I speak about leadership, I am often asked who my favorite leaders are. The smart people would skirt the question, but I don’t. The reality is, I have several favorite leaders for different reasons. Currently, I’m leadership-crushing on Raj Singh, because he truly is one of the most authentic people I know. So it was no surprise that when I posed the question in a blog post–“Raj Singh! What’s your ONE Must Have?”–he quickly replied to the post (how cool was that!?). That was several years ago, and as I’ve gotten to know Raj, I am continually moved by his authenticity. I’m excited to see the impact he’ll make in his new role as CEO of Accolade.

And if you’re still wondering what the one behavior or trait Raj thinks every leader must-have in order to be great, it was authenticity. “Everything is built off of that. I think it’s the foundational element of leadership: Being comfortable enough in your own skin to be yourself — and to tell the truth.”

Late last year, Rajeev Singh announced he would join the on-demand health care concierge service company Accolade and open a headquarters office for the Philadelphia company in Seattle.
